4,295,009,670 (four billion two hundred ninety-five million nine thousand six hundred seventy) is an even 10-digit number. It is a composite number with 32 divisors, and factors as 2 × 3 × 5 × 7 × 20,452,427. Its proper divisors sum to 7,485,588,858,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x10000A586.
